How to fill out 1 business privacy policy

01
Start by identifying all the types of personal information your business collects from customers or visitors.
02
Outline how this information is collected, stored, and used within your organization.
03
Detail the security measures in place to protect this information from unauthorized access or breaches.
04
Specify how customers can access, review, and request changes to their personal information.
05
Include a section about how you handle data sharing with third parties, if applicable.
06
Clearly explain the conditions under which personal information may be disclosed, such as legal requirements or business partnerships.
07
Provide contact information for customers to reach out with privacy concerns or questions.
08
Review and update your privacy policy regularly to ensure compliance with legal regulations and industry standards.

1 business privacy policy is a legal document that outlines how a business collects, uses, and protects the personal information of its customers and employees.
Any business that collects personal information from customers or employees is required to have a privacy policy in place.
To fill out a business privacy policy, the business owner or designated Privacy Officer should include information on what personal data is collected, how it is used, who it is shared with, and how it is protected.
The purpose of a business privacy policy is to inform individuals about how their personal information is being used and to ensure transparency and trust between the business and its customers or employees.
A business privacy policy must include information about the types of personal data collected, how it is used, who it is shared with, how it is protected, and how individuals can exercise their rights regarding their data.
